1. Get Into TikTok

TikTok has taken the social media world by storm, becoming a major platform for both entertainment and marketing. By 2025, its influence is expected to grow even further. With over 1 billion active users, TikTok provides businesses with a unique opportunity to reach younger audiences through short-form, engaging video content.  

Brands can leverage TikTok’s algorithm, which prioritizes creativity and engagement, to go viral and reach new audiences. For example, businesses can participate in trending challenges, create behind-the-scenes videos, or showcase their products in innovative ways. TikTok also offers advertising opportunities through features like In-Feed Ads and Branded Hashtag Challenges. Even small businesses can find success on TikTok, as the platform levels the playing field for creators of all sizes.  

2. Personalized Email Campaigns Through AI 

Email marketing continues to be one of the most effective channels for engagement and conversion, but personalization is becoming increasingly important. By 2025, artificial intelligence (AI) will revolutionize email campaigns, allowing businesses to create highly tailored messages for their customers.  

AI can analyze customer data, such as purchase history, preferences, and browsing behavior, to craft personalized emails that resonate with each recipient. For instance, a clothing retailer might send product recommendations based on a customer’s previous purchases, while an e-commerce brand could offer exclusive discounts to users who abandoned their carts.  

Personalized email campaigns not only improve open and click-through rates but also foster stronger relationships with customers. With AI-powered tools, businesses can send the right message to the right person at the right time, increasing the likelihood of conversion.  

3. Instagram for E-Commerce 

Instagram remains one of the most influential platforms for e-commerce businesses. Its visually-driven content format makes it an ideal space for brands to showcase products, engage with their audience, and drive sales. Features like Instagram Shops, product tagging, and in-app checkout streamline the buying process, making it easier for customers to purchase directly from the platform.  

By 2025, Instagram will continue to evolve as a hub for e-commerce. Businesses should focus on creating high-quality content that captures attention and drives engagement. This includes visually stunning product photos, interactive Stories, and short Reels that highlight product features or tutorials.  

Collaborating with influencers on Instagram is another effective way to build trust and expand your reach. Influencers can promote your products authentically, providing social proof and encouraging their followers to take action. With the right strategy, Instagram can be a powerful tool for driving conversions and building brand loyalty.  

4. Prioritize User-Generated Content (UGC)  

User-generated content (UGC) is becoming increasingly valuable in the marketing world. UGC includes any content created by customers, such as reviews, photos, or videos, and is considered one of the most authentic forms of marketing. It builds trust, provides social proof, and fosters community around your brand.  

For instance, a skincare brand might feature customer testimonials or before-and-after photos on its website. At the same time, a travel company could encourage customers to share their vacation experiences on social media using a branded hashtag. Highlighting UGC not only strengthens customer relationships but also saves time and resources for businesses.  

To encourage UGC, businesses can create campaigns that reward customers for sharing their experiences or run contests with branded hashtags. Featuring UGC on product pages, social media, or marketing campaigns can significantly boost engagement and conversions.  

5. Increase Video Marketing

Video marketing is no longer optional—it’s essential. As consumers increasingly prefer video content, platforms like YouTube, TikTok, and Instagram dominate the digital space. Video allows businesses to showcase products, tell stories, and connect dynamically and engagingly with their audience.  

By 2025, live video will also become a critical component of marketing strategies. Live streams on platforms like Facebook or Instagram allow businesses to interact with their audience in real-time, answer questions, and create a sense of urgency through exclusive offers or announcements.  

Short-form videos, such as Instagram Reels or TikToks, are ideal for capturing attention, while long-form videos on YouTube can provide in-depth product tutorials, customer testimonials, or behind-the-scenes content. Incorporating video into your marketing strategy will help you stay relevant and connect with audiences across multiple platforms.  

6. Metaverse Hype Dies Down

While the metaverse has been a buzzword in recent years, its initial hype is beginning to settle. In 2025, businesses are taking a more practical approach to integrating metaverse-related elements into their marketing strategies. Instead of heavily investing in virtual worlds, brands are focusing on practical applications like virtual showrooms, interactive product demos, and augmented reality (AR) experiences.  

The shift in focus reflects a preference for strategies with proven ROI, such as social media marketing and SEO services, over speculative investments. Businesses looking to adopt metaverse elements should prioritize features that enhance user experience without overcomplicating their marketing strategy.  

7. AI Is Changing the Way Marketing Is Done 

Artificial intelligence is transforming the marketing landscape, offering tools that streamline processes, improve personalization, and enhance decision-making. From predictive analytics to chatbots, AI enables businesses to engage with customers more efficiently and effectively.  

AI-powered tools can analyze vast amounts of data to identify trends, optimize ad targeting, and predict customer behavior. For example, a chatbot can provide instant customer support, while AI algorithms can determine the best time to post on social media for maximum engagement. As AI continues to evolve, it will become an integral part of digital marketing strategies, helping businesses save time, reduce costs, and drive better results.
